Panel to celebrate Black History Month by discussing pioneers of the black press Feb. 25

In honor of Black History Month, the Book and Author Committee will host a discussion of pioneers of the black press Wednesday, Feb. 25, from 6:30 p.m. to 8:00 p.m.

Panelists include Carol Booker, editor of "Alone Atop the Hill: The Autobiography of Alice Dunnigan, Pioneer of the National Black Press" and James McGrath Morris, author of "Eye on the Struggle: Ethel Payne, the First Lady of the Black Press."

The event includes a panel discussion, questions from the audience, and book signing.
